60 Fun and Easy Kids Craft Ideas with Paper
1. Paper Plate Masks
Create fun animal or superhero masks using paper plates and colors.
2. Origami Animals
Make simple origami animals like frogs, dogs, or butterflies.
3. Paper Mosaics
Cut colored paper into small squares to design unique mosaics.
4. Handprint Art
Use cut-out handprints to create trees, animals, or greeting cards.
5. Paper Cup Flowers
Transform paper cups into beautiful flowers with a few simple cuts.
6. Accordion Paper Snakes
Fold paper in an accordion style to make fun wiggly snakes.
7. Paper Fans
Make decorative paper fans with colorful patterns and designs.
8. 3D Paper Stars
Create stunning 3D stars using folded and glued paper pieces.
9. Torn Paper Collage
Tear paper into small pieces and arrange them into creative artworks.
10. DIY Paper Kites
Craft tiny indoor kites with paper, sticks, and strings.
11. Paper Chain Decorations
Make long paper chains for parties, holidays, or room decor.
12. Paper Bag Puppets
Turn paper bags into puppets with fun faces and decorations.
13. Spinning Paper Tops
Cut and assemble paper circles to make fun spinning tops.
14. Paper Weaving Mats
Weave colored paper strips to create pretty woven mats.
15. Easy Paper Pinwheels
Fold paper into pinwheels and attach them to straws or sticks.
16. DIY Paper Crowns
Make paper crowns decorated with stickers and glitter.
17. Folded Paper Tulips
Create beautiful tulip flowers using folded colored paper.
18. Cupcake Liner Butterflies
Use cupcake liners and paper to make adorable butterfly crafts.
19. Paper Tunnels for Toy Cars
Fold paper into tunnels for a fun toy car race track.
20. Stained Glass Paper Art
Use tissue paper to create a stained-glass window effect.
21. Paper Plate Clocks
Teach kids to read time with DIY paper plate clocks.
22. Silhouette Paper Cutouts
Create silhouettes of animals, people, or nature using black paper.
23. DIY Paper Envelopes
Make your own personalized paper envelopes for letters or gifts.
24. Rainbow Paper Chains
Link paper rings in rainbow colors to decorate rooms or events.
25. Cut-and-Fold Paper Dolls
Make paper dolls and dress them up in different outfits.
26. DIY Paper Lanterns
Create decorative paper lanterns for festivals or celebrations.
27. Paper Quilling Art
Use paper strips to make beautiful quilled designs.
28. Popsicle Stick and Paper Flags
Combine paper and popsicle sticks to make mini flags.
29. DIY Paper Spinner Wheels
Craft spinning wheels that twirl when blown or flicked.
30. Paper Roll Binoculars
Glue paper rolls together and decorate them for pretend play.
31. DIY Paper Tiaras
Make fancy paper tiaras with glitter and gems for princess play.
32. Paper Fish Aquarium
Create a 3D aquarium with fish cutouts and blue paper.
33. Moving Paper Puppets
Make puppets with movable arms and legs using brads.
34. Origami Jumping Frogs
Fold paper into jumping frogs that leap when pressed.
35. Layered Paper Rainbows
Create rainbows by layering paper strips in an arc.
36. Paper Wind Chimes
Decorate paper cutouts and string them together for a chime effect.
37. Paper Leaf Garland
Cut and string colorful paper leaves for seasonal decor.
38. DIY Paper Picture Frames
Make cute frames from paper for displaying drawings or photos.
39. Paper Spiral Snakes
Cut a paper spiral to create a fun hanging snake decoration.
40. DIY Paper Greeting Cards
Design personalized cards for birthdays and holidays.
41. Tissue Paper Flowers
Make fluffy tissue paper flowers in different colors.
42. Paper Roll Owls
Decorate paper rolls to make adorable owl crafts.
43. Folded Paper Heart Chains
Make pretty heart chains by folding and linking paper.
44. DIY Paper Telescope
Roll paper into a fun pretend-play telescope.
45. Paper Strip Art
Use paper strips to create geometric art and designs.
46. Simple Paper Airplanes
Fold different styles of paper airplanes for flying fun.
47. Paper Bunny Masks
Make bunny masks with ears and whiskers for pretend play.
48. Origami Paper Boats
Fold boats and float them in water for an exciting experiment.
49. Paper Straw Rockets
Blow through a straw to launch a paper rocket.
50. DIY Paper Bracelets
Make and decorate paper bracelets for fun accessories.
51. Paper Plate Dinosaurs
Use paper plates to create dinosaur shapes and characters.
52. Pop-Up Paper Cards
Make greeting cards with pop-up paper designs.
53. Paper City Buildings
Create a cityscape by making paper houses and buildings.
54. Paper Fortune Tellers
Fold classic fortune tellers for a fun interactive game.
55. Paper Cup Bunny Ears
Use paper cups to craft bunny ears for dress-up.
56. DIY Paper Leaf Prints
Paint leaves and press them on paper for natural prints.
57. Accordion Fold Paper Butterflies
Fold and fan out paper to create butterfly wings.
58. Paper Star Garland
Make a star garland for decorating walls or parties.
59. Paper Caterpillar Chain
Link paper circles to create a cute caterpillar.
60. DIY Paper Treasure Map
Draw a pirate treasure map on paper and age it with tea.
